IBD Symposium - Part 1: Advantages and Considerations
Monitoring of Quality, Optimising Diagnosis and Diagnostic Doubt. The discussion revolved around selecting optimal imaging for Crohn's disease: ultrasound's availability, CT angiography's emergency use, and MR enterography's precision in inflammation versus fibrosis assessment.
